## Summary

Hanover (Scotland) Housing Association Ltd is seeking to award a contract titled "Legionella Compliance Contract," focusing on the maintenance and safety of residential accommodation primarily involving rented sheltered and very sheltered housing in the Central Belt of Scotland and other mainland sites. The tender process is currently in the 'Award' stage. The procurement, initiated on 19 August 2016, follows a selective method under a restricted procedure, with a budget of £75,000 per annum. The contract duration is three years, with an option to extend for an additional two years, and the submission deadline for tenders was 19 September 2016.

## Notice

Periodic Servicing and Inspection, Routine & Responsive Maintenance and Out of Hours Emergency Callouts to residential accommodation; mainly rented sheltered and very sheltered housing complexes with some amenity housing and general needs housing. Approximate number of properties within the contract 4200. A contractor operated portal which can record all documentation to ensure L8 compliance must be available within four weeks of contract acceptance. Risk assessment identified remedial works will be included within the contract, average budget 75,000.00 per annum. M3NHF Schedule version 6.3 will form contract documetation.

### Lot Information

Lot 1

The works will require entry to tenanted properties to gain access to loft situated water tanks and also for temperature testing and remedial works to sentinel and representative taps, thermostatic mixing valves, cylinders and water heaters and shower heads. Associated works may include but are not exclusively: - Tagging of sentinel taps, drinking water outlets, calorifiers etc. - Supply & installation of temperature gauges - Clean & disinfection of tanks - Recalibration of TMVs / tap & shower thermostats where required - Adjustment of thermostats where required - Re-routing of vents to tundish - Minor pipe work reconfiguration / alteration - Supply & installation of fly screen / insect filters - Supply & installation of lid vents The contractor will be required to produce hard copies and CD copies of a log book recording the work done. One log book will be kept on all Very sheltered and sheltered developments only and a CD copy of all developments will be kept at the Associations offices. All laboratory sample certificates will require to be provided which will include shower head certificates and temperature gauge certificates. The Association will retain the right for their own employees to undertake some of the weekly testing requirements in a selection of properties. The Contract will be awarded for a period of three years, with an option to extend the contract on a yearly basis for a further two years. The contract will be subject to review on a regular basis and satisfactory performance against published Key Performance Indicators. It will be a condition of this contract that the Contractor must use a properly accredited and independent water testing laboratory to carry out the water testing works in accordance with the HSE's Legionnaires Disease ACOP L8. The Association will reserve the right to add or omit other works and or addresses from the contract during the contract and any extension period. Factored properties and the Association's offices will also be included within the contract.
